Safe compliance

Goods-related export controls, sanctions lists and embargoes: There are numerous regulations that must be observed in foreign trade. In some cases, these regulations not only apply to the import and export of goods, but also govern the admissibility of contracts or negotiations. 
In order to be legally secure, trade compliance, i.e. an audit of compliance with all regulations, must be ensured at an early stage - which can be a challenge given the large number of requirements and, depending on the size of the company, can be very time-consuming.

FAQ

The most important information on the subject of trade compliance:

Trade compliance deals with the observance of regulations and laws in foreign trade. Various sets of rules, such as controls on certain goods, sanctions and embargoes, must be taken into account.

Compliance with legal requirements on foreign trade relations is mandatory for companies. A violation can result in fines and other legal consequences, which can sometimes threaten the existence of companies. Even on a small scale, companies can avoid delays in the shipment of their goods if they ensure that they act "compliantly".

Certain goods are subject to restrictions and prohibitions in foreign trade. Companies must ensure that they comply with the relevant legal regulations on export control, such as the EU Dual-Use Regulation, German foreign trade law or the US Export Administration Regulations (US EAR). The prerequisite for this is a precise review of all export processes and the associated supporting documents with regard to export restrictions and bans.

Sanctions lists name organizations, companies or individuals that are subject to economic or legal restrictions. They regulate which business relationships you are allowed to enter into - or not. Sanctions lists are drawn up, for example, by individual countries or by the EU.

An embargo regulates prohibitions and restrictions on the export and import of goods. An embargo is not always imposed on a specific state, but can also affect certain goods as a partial embargo or be imposed on groups of persons or individuals. An embargo is usually based on political differences or objectives. The aim is often to persuade a state to give in to a conflict.
